Armenia President, Russian commander discuss POW returnFebruary 24, 2021 - 18:42 AMT PanARMENIAN.Net - President Armen Sarkissian on Wednesday, February 24 hosted Lieutenant General Rustam Muradov, the commander of the Russian peacekeeping contingent in Nagorno-Karabakh, to discuss a number of issues, including the repatriation of Armenian captives. Colonel Andrey Grischuk, the military attaché of the Russian Embassy in Armenia, and Boris Avagyan, the special representative of the President of Artsakh, also participated in the meeting. General Muradov told the President of Armenia about the implementation of the tasks given to the peacekeepers, emphasizing the warm attitude of the people of Nagorno-Karabakh towards the Russian servicemen. The two discussed issues related to the return of Armenian prisoners of war and civilians held on the Azerbaijani side, the mission to find the missing persons, and their transfer to the Armenian side. Armen Sarkissian said Azerbaijan is hindering the search operations, which is unacceptable, and added that resolving such highly sensitive and vital matters is urgent. During the discussion, they also weighed in on the demarcation and delimitation processes on the Armenian-Azerbaijani border. President Sarkissian stressed the importance of protecting Armenia's borders and especially the security of border communities.
